



A boat carrying dozens of people capsized in the Mekong River on Sunday, leaving nearly 30 people missing, local authorities in Chiang Rai province said. The incident occurred near the Golden Triangle Special Economic Zone in Bokeo Province, Laos. According to a local tour boat operator, the accident was likely caused by engine failure and strong currents.
All passengers were not wearing life jackets.“The boat was too small and overloaded, and no one was wearing a life jacket,” said the police chief of Chiang Saen district.Despite search efforts, no additional victims have been found. It is anticipated that any unrecovered bodies will float to the surface in the next two days.
